Four types of dorms. One is called The Towers and it's typical dorm living-mixed floor of boys and girls with a common area on each floor. The floors are rectangular and any and every kind of major lives in these. More fun and party oriented. Two is the red bricks, which is living specified by major. Good for studying and getting study groups. Meet a lot of people in major but not as social. Third is north mountain-bigger rooms but not as social. Kind of removed from the towers and red bricks. Last is cerro vista which is apartment style. Not social and harder to meet people. But nicest rooms and area to live.
